Colorado Springs (CO) Zip Codes: United States
| Area Name | Zip Code |
|---|---|
| Colorado Springs | 80901 80902 80903 80904 80905 80906 80907 80908 80909 80910 80911 80912 80913 80914 80915 80916 80917 80918 80919 80920 80921 80922 80923 80924 80925 80926 80927 80928 80929 80930 80931 80932 80933 80934 80935 80936 80937 80938 80939 80941 80942 80944 80946 80947 80949 80950 80951 80960 80962 80970 80977 80995 80997 |
